WebDuring a period of DOAC+AED treatment of 10±9 months (range 1-27 months), no adverse events were reported. Conclusions: In our experience, concurrent treatment with AED and DOAC usually did not lead to a reduction in drug concentration. In a clinical follow-up, in both AF and VTE patients, no adverse events due to reduced DOACs effect have ... WebThe majority were case reports (n = 21) documenting a single adverse event resulting from a suspected DOAC DDI, while the remaining papers were a case series (n = 1) and cohort studies (n = 2). The most commonly reported interacting drugs were amiodarone and ritonavir (bleeding), and phenobarbital, phenytoin, and carbamazepine (thrombosis). diy lift top coffee table mechanism

WebNov 28, 2024 · Serum total phenytoin level was within therapeutic level of 14.3 mg/dL and serum creatinine was 0.98 mg/dL. Coagulation studies were found to be within normal limits. On admission a drug-drug interaction (category-X: contraindicated drug administered) between phenytoin and apixaban was noted, resulting in decreased serum apixaban level. WebJun 7, 2024 · Increased DOAC concentrations can result in bleeding episodes, whereas reduced DOAC efficacy with a potential for thrombus formation is possible during drug … WebFeb 2, 2024 · Phenytoin (Dilantin, Phenytek) is an antiseizure medication that has many possible interactions. This includes other seizure medications, antidepressants, and anticoagulants. Some phenytoin interactions lead to higher or lower levels of phenytoin. Higher levels of phenytoin can cause side effects like drowsiness or confusion.
